AN ASIAN family has been left deeply upset after being subjected to a torrent of racial abuse at their home.
Police are trying to trace the culprit, who gave Nazi-type salutes as he insulted the family in the Stanley area, on Saturday, May 6, at 8.45pm.
Detective Constable Shaun Bailey said: "The family were in their home when the man with a bulldog-type dog started shouting racial abuse at them.
"When one of them went to investigate, they were confronted by the man who showed a Nazi-style salute and continued to shout abuse of a racial nature at them.
"He was in front of their house for about ten minutes, and his behaviour provoked some children in the area to start throwing things at the house.
"The victims, who have lived in the area for 20 years, were very upset and say it is the worst incident of racial abuse they have experienced.
"This kind of behaviour is completely unacceptable and we are appealing for information to help us trace this man."
The culprit has been described as 5ft 3in, of medium build, with short, dark brown hair. He was wearing a red football strip.
